What does the product do?
Unizest is a digital app that provides e-current accounts for newcomers to the UK - namely overseas workers and international students. As well as providing accounts direct to customers, we partner with recruitment agencies in order to help them recruit and retain international candidates by providing a much needed digital banking solution, specifically tailored to the needs of non-UK nationals.
